Wifredo Lam - Ocher Figure - Signed Lithograph

Wifredo Lam - Ocher Figure

Original lithograph on Arches paper
Signed in pencil and numbered 27/100
Publisher's dry stamp
Publisher: Erker-Presse, St.​Gallen, 1975
Reference: Tonneau-Ryckelnyck 7509, 3 state

76 x 56.5cm

Wifredo Lam : (1902-1982) Wifredo Óscar de la Concepción Lam y Castilla, aka Wifredo Lam, was born in Sagua La Grande, (Cuba) on December 8th, 1902 and died in Paris on September 11th, 1982. Cuban painter, and promoter of a mixed-race painting, blending occidental modernism and african & caribbean symbols, thus creating a singular and contemporary langage. He was close to Picasso, the surrealists as well, who considered him as one of theirs. He also rubbed shoulders with the Imaginistes, Phases and CoBrA.
